|
Obiettivi
|
|
Il corso
tratterà tecniche algoritmiche avanzate che sorgono
nella gestione di reti di comunicazione e trasporto. Molti
degli argomenti trattati saranno relativi a risultati ottenuti
dalla comunità scientifica internazionale negli ultimi
dieci anni. Particolare enfasi verrà posta su problemi
di cammino su grafi che sorgono in applicazioni come instradamento
di pacchetti, gestione di navigatori satellitari e reti di
sensori. Durante
lo svolgimento delle lezioni verranno evidenziati vari problemi
aperti nelle aree studiate come stimolo per attività
di ricerca future. Il corso affronterà questioni sia
metodologiche che applicative nello sviluppo di software robusto
ed efficiente per problemi di rilevanza industriale.
|
|
| Avvisi |
|
5 Luglio
I grafi di test per la gara di programmazione saranno i grafi stradali USA (non orientati) scaricabili alla pagina download del DIMACS challenge. Le sequenze di update nei file .dss saranno generate scegliendo archi da cancellare casualmente.
13 Giugno
E' disponibile il regolamento di un gara di programmazione indetta per il corso.
18 Maggio
La lezione del giovedi è spostata permanentemente al mercoledi in aula 17 dalle 15:45 alle 17:15.
14 Maggio
Dal 6 giugno all'8 giugno 2007 nell'aula del chiostro della sede di Via Eudossiana si terrà un workshop (WEA 2007) su tematiche attinenti al corso. In particolare, il 6 giugno dalle 9:00 alle 10:00 vi sarà una relazione del Prof. Peter Sanders sul tema dei cammini minimi. Tutti gli studenti del corso sono invitati a partecipare.
|
|
|
|
Prerequisiti
|
|
Si assume
familiarità degli studenti con gli argomenti di alcuni
dei corsi della laurea di primo livello come Analisi matematica,
Calcolo delle probabilità e statistica, Algoritmi e
strutture dati, e Informatica teorica.
|
|
|
Orari
ed aule
|
|
Il corso viene erogato nel 3° trimestre dal 24 Aprile al 21 Giugno 2007. Le lezioni si svolgono presso la Facoltà
di Ingegneria in V.Eudossiana 18 secondo il seguente orario.
| Martedi (aula 30) |
Mercoledi (aula 10) |
Mercoledi (aula 17) |
| 10.15-11.45 |
10.15-11.45 |
15.45-17.15 |
Eventuali
variazioni verranno comunicate dal docente in aula e appariranno
su questa pagina alla voce Avvisi.
|
|
|
Diario
delle lezioni
|
|
L' elenco
degli argomenti del corso e il diario delle lezioni è
disponibile qui.
|
|
Gara di programmazione
|
|
E' indetta una gara di programmazione sul problema del mantenimento dinamico delle distanze da una sorgente prefissata in un grafo diretto non pesato soggetto a cancellazioni di archi. Il regolamento è disponibile qui.
|
|
|
Ricevimento
studenti
|
Il ricevimento studenti è effettuato durante lo svolgimento del corso ogni martedi dalle ore 14:30 alle ore 16:30 in via Ariosto 25, I piano, ufficio B115. In date successive il ricevimento verrà effettuato su appuntamento (per contattare il docente, scrivere all'indirizzo: demetres
[at] dis [dot] uniroma1
[dot] it.
|
|
|
Esami
|
|
L'esame consiste in una prova orale (obbligatoria) e nello svolgimento di progetto software (facoltativo) sugli argomenti del corso. Il calendario degli esami verrà comunicato in seguito. Per sostenere l'esame, è necessario prenotarsi contattando il docente per email.
|
|
|
|
|
Sito
web ottimizzato per risoluzione 800x600 o superiore.
Ultimo aggiornamento: 5 Luglio 2007 - |
|
|